演示
看它如何工作。
一条命令即时切换账号。
~/dev
gcam
Gemini CLI 账号管理器
当前账号: alice@gmail.com ●
账号池:
[*]alice@gmail.com 使用中
[ ]bob@developer.io
[ ]carol@startup.co
~/dev
gcam next
✓ 已切换到下一个账号: bob@developer.io
~/dev
gcam quota
gemini-2.5-flash
68%
gemini-2.5-pro
23%
gemini-2.0-flash
91%
功能
为开发者而生
让终端成为你的超能力。
即时切换
毫秒级账号切换。无需重启、无需重新认证、零摩擦。
原子操作
凭证更新使用临时文件 + 重命名,防止并发访问下的数据损坏。
自动配额轮换
当配额达到阈值时,gcam 会静默切换到下一个可用账号。
账号池
通过 OAuth 浏览器登录添加无限账号,一个命令管理全部。
实时配额
通过 Google Cloud Code API 查询各模型的剩余配额,提前规避限额。
斜杠命令
安装后直接在 Gemini CLI 内使用 /gcam,无需切换上下文。
Go
零运行时依赖。一个静态二进制文件。
3系统
macOS、Linux、Windows,一个工具全平台通用。
0依赖
纯 Go 标准库,无额外依赖。
1命令
gcam install 几秒内完成所有配置。
命令参考
你需要的所有命令。
简单、直观、功能强大。
账号管理
| gcam | 列出所有账号及状态 |
| gcam <n> | 切换到指定索引的账号 |
| gcam <邮箱> | 切换到指定邮箱的账号 |
| gcam next | 切换到池中的下一个账号 |
系统
| gcam quota | 显示配额使用情况 |
| gcam pool login | 通过 OAuth 添加账号 |
| gcam menu | 交互式管理界面 |
| gcam install | 安装钩子和命令 |
| gcam uninstall | 移除所有钩子 |
安装
60 秒快速上手。
一步构建、一步安装,即刻成为账号管理大师。
1
从源码构建
克隆并使用 Go 编译,几秒完成
2
安装钩子
启用斜杠命令和 shell 集成
3
登录账号
通过 OAuth 浏览器流程添加账号
# 克隆仓库
git clone https://github.com/dong4j/gemini-cli-account-manager.git
cd gemini-cli-account-manager
# 构建二进制文件
go build -o gcam cmd/gcam/main.go
# 安装钩子(可选)
./gcam install
# 添加第一个账号
./gcam pool login
# 开始使用 Gemini CLI
gemini --account gcam